Full Job Description
Landmarc Support Services are recruiting a Maintenance Supervisor to oversee and coordinate day-to-day maintenance activities at Longmoor Training Camp. This is a hands-on coordination role where you will support the Maintenance Manager, manage work orders through our digital systems, and ensure all planned and reactive tasks are delivered safely, efficiently, and in line with compliance standards. You will be the central point for scheduling, prioritising, and monitoring maintenance activity, working closely with contractors, internal teams, and the Defence Infrastructure Organisation (DIO). Strong IT skills and confidence using maintenance management systems are essential. This role is ideal for someone with experience in hard FM or maintenance coordination, or someone looking to progress their career within a structured and supportive FM environment. Main Responsibilities
- Coordinate and prioritise planned, preventative, and reactive maintenance tasks
- Manage work orders and reporting through internal maintenance systems (advanced Excel required)
- Support the Maintenance Manager with daily operational planning
- Liaise with internal teams, contractors, and the DIO to ensure smooth delivery
- Maintain accurate Health & Safety and compliance documentation
- Monitor progress of maintenance activities and update schedules accordingly
- Act as the site lead for maintenance systems, processes, and safe working practices
- Participate in the on-call rota
Experienced in hard FM, maintenance coordination, or workload scheduling - Strong understanding of Health & Safety requirements (COSHH, risk assessments, IOSH Managing Safely)
- Confident communicator able to work with multiple stakeholders
- Advanced user of Microsoft applications
- Organised, calm under pressure, and able to manage competing priorities
- Full UK driving licence (essential)
- Experience with CAFM systems and SFG20 standards (desirable)

View full company profileLandmarc provides the support services that enable our Armed Forces to live, work and train on the UK Defence Training Estate. This includes consultancy, design, management and operation of training areas and ranges; explosives safety; built and rural estate management, including environmental and conservation support; information management and administration services; project management and commercial property management. We are currently 1,300 people strong and active across 120 sites across the UK. The company is jointly owned by Mitie and PAE. www.landmarcsolutions.com | twitter:@landmarcNEWS | LinkedIn: LandmarcSolutions Prerequisites for employment - Full driving licence valid in the United Kingdom - Complete Baseline Personnel Security Standard this is compulsory for all personnel who work for Landmarc Support Services Limited as Official Defence Contractors. This includes a Basic Police Disclosure, however, unspent convictions are not necessarily a bar to employment and will be reviewed case by case to ensure there are no risks to the security and integrity of the work completed by Landmarc Support Services Limited. - National Security Vetting may be required however you will be informed of this requirement during completion of the Baseline Personnel Security Standard. - Candidates must meet the UK residency requirements to undergo the above (5 years minimum).
